HTTPS跳转最佳实践

随着互联网技术的不断发展,网络安全问题日益受到人们的关注。
HTTP协议作为互联网上应用最广泛的协议之一,由于其传输数据时不进行加密,存在着安全隐患。
因此,HTTPS应运而生,它在HTTP的基础上加入了SSL/TLS加密技术,确保了数据传输的安全性。
在实际应用中,为了实现网站的安全性和用户体验的平衡,HTTPS跳转成为了一种重要的实践。
本文将介绍HTTPS跳转的最佳实践。

一、什么是HTTPS跳转?

HTTPS跳转是指用户在访问一个网站的HTTP协议链接时,通过一系列的技术手段自动跳转到相应的HTTPS协议链接的过程。
通过HTTPS跳转,可以确保用户访问的网站数据在传输过程中是安全的,避免了数据被窃取或篡改的风险。
同时,HTTPS跳转还可以提高网站的可信度和用户体验。

二、HTTPS跳转的重要性

1. 增强网站安全性:HTTPS采用SSL/TLS加密技术,能够有效防止数据在传输过程中被窃取或篡改,提高了网站的安全性。
2. 提升用户体验:HTTPS跳转可以确保用户在访问网站时,始终访问到安全的链接,避免了因HTTP链接被篡改而导致的访问错误或恶意内容的问题,提高了用户体验。
3. 提高搜索引擎排名:搜索引擎对HTTPS网站更加友好,采用HTTPS跳转的网站在搜索引擎中的排名可能会更高。

三、HTTPS跳转最佳实践

1. 逐步迁移:对于已经存在的网站,建议逐步进行HTTPS迁移。对部分页面进行HTTPS部署和测试,确保没有问题后再逐步推广到其他页面。这样可以避免一次性迁移带来的风险和问题。
2. 配置服务器:确保服务器已经安装了SSL证书,并正确配置了HTTPS的相关设置。服务器应该支持HTTP到HTTPS的自动跳转,以确保用户访问的链接都是安全的。
3. 重定向规则:在服务器配置中设置HTTP到HTTPS的重定向规则。当用户访问HTTP链接时,服务器会自动将用户重定向到相应的HTTPS链接。这样可以确保用户始终访问到安全的链接。
4. 更新所有链接:在网站代码中,将所有的HTTP链接更新为HTTPS链接。这包括网站内部的链接、外部链接、图片链接等。同时,也要确保第三方服务(如社交媒体插件、支付插件等)的链接也是安全的HTTPS链接。
5. 监测和优化:在完成HTTPS跳转后,需要监测网站的性能和安全性。确保HTTPS跳转没有导致网站性能下降或产生其他问题。同时,要定期更新SSL证书,确保网站的安全性。
6. 引导用户更新浏览器:由于部分老旧的浏览器可能不支持HTTPS,因此,在网站首页或其他显眼位置引导用户更新浏览器,以确保用户可以正常访问网站并享受到安全的服务。
7. 测试和验证:在完成HTTPS跳转后,需要进行全面的测试和验证。测试包括功能测试、性能测试、安全测试等,确保HTTPS跳转没有影响到网站的正常运行和用户体验。同时,要验证SSL证书的有效性和网站的加密状态。
8. 用户教育和宣传:除了技术层面的措施外,还需要对用户进行教育和宣传。让用户了解HTTP的不安全性和HTTPS的重要性,提高用户的安全意识,使用户更加信任和使用HTTPS网站。

四、总结

HTTPS跳转是保障网站安全性和用户体验的重要实践。
通过逐步迁移、配置服务器、设置重定向规则、更新所有链接、监测和优化、引导用户更新浏览器、测试和验证以及用户教育和宣传等措施,可以实现有效的HTTPS跳转。
在实际应用中,需要根据具体情况选择合适的方案,确保网站的安全性和用户体验。


易语言有好用的能https带cookie进行post的方法吗

不知道你用的是HTTP读文件()还是模块中的网页_访问()。 HTTP读文件是没有办法得到Cookies的。 网页_访问()中一般会有一个叫Cookies或者返回Cookies的参数。 你在这个参数中填入一个文本型变量,然后网页_访问()这个命令就会把Cookies赋值到这个...

https:// 221.208.0.214

您好!您访问是中国联通黑龙江飞公司远程接入系统,使用的沃通CA的OV SSL证书,实现https加密访问,但是其证书过期,没有进行续期,所有现在https访问浏览器会有风险提示。 要解决此问题,请到证书签发机构续期证书。

在只能使用系统光盘自带的rpm包的情况下,Linux用appche怎么实现https功能

任务占坑